Output f0044780ae69f3115e657e0f80564e07ba2ba967a6df11bbbc136fd2562408e6:17

value
176526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4f576af16ade8f0a39ab6e35ca3209e7ced3b23 OP_EQUAL
address
3NZe3Pfm221WjqyMLMkfUwvwy74xDyvyLs
transaction
f0044780ae69f3115e657e0f80564e07ba2ba967a6df11bbbc136fd2562408e6
confirmations
190407
spent
true